A poetic story about domestic violence, child abuse, rape and the overcoming. Serpent is used as a metaphor throughout to describe harmful and toxic people that make us feel inferior as a human being. Anyone and everyone who appears harmless filling roles of lovers, relatives, parents, and friendships in our lives. It is a story to be read cautiously to thoroughly understand through humility and empathy is how we can help each other overcome trauma. This poetic story is written using spanglish language to embody the Latin-American communties. Everyone can see it
